1. What Is Ozempic?

Ozempic is a prescription medication originally developed for type‑2 diabetes. Its generic name is semaglutide, and it belongs to a class called GLP‑1 receptor agonists.

How it works:
✔️ Signals the brain to reduce appetite
✔️ Slows digestion so you feel full longer
✔️ Helps lower glucose levels in the blood

Doctors noticed that people taking Ozempic consistently lost weight — sometimes significantly — even when they weren’t diabetic.

This discovery led to a new trend: using Ozempic for medically supervised weight loss.

3. How Does Ozempic Actually Aid Weight Loss?

Ozempic goes beyond just “burning calories”. Its mechanism is medical, not cosmetic.

Here’s how it works:

Appetite Control

Ozempic affects appetite‑regulating hormones. You feel full faster, eat less, and naturally reduce calorie intake.

Delayed Gastric Emptying

Your stomach empties slower, meaning your body processes food at a more controlled pace — and you stay satisfied longer.

Improved Blood Sugar Regulation

While Pakistani readers might not be diabetic, this benefit helps control sudden hunger pangs and sugar crashes — a major factor in weight gain.

6. Common Side Effects (And What to Expect)

Like all medications, Ozempic may cause side effects. Most are mild and temporary, but it’s good to know what they can be:

Usually Mild (Temporary)

✔ Nausea
✔ Vomiting
✔ Bloating
✔ Diarrhea
✔ Constipation

These often occur in the first weeks as the body adjusts.

Requiring Medical Attention

Rare but important:

❗ Severe abdominal pain
❗ Persistent vomiting
❗ Signs of pancreatitis (inflammation of the pancreas)
❗ Allergic reactions

Remember: Discuss any symptom with a doctor immediately.

8. Who Should Avoid Ozempic?

While Ozempic can help many, it’s not safe for everyone — especially without doctor supervision.

Avoid if you:

❌ Are pregnant or breastfeeding
❌ Have a history of pancreatitis
❌ Have certain digestive disorders
❌ Are allergic to semaglutide or similar medications
❌ Are using Ozempic without medical prescription


9. The Importance of Medical Monitoring

Getting Ozempic injection in Islamabad is one thing — but monitoring makes it safe and effective.

Your doctor should check:

✔ Weight progress
✔ Blood sugar levels
✔ Liver and kidney function
✔ Appetite changes
✔ Gastrointestinal comfort

Regular follow‑ups also help adjust dosages safely.
